Villeneuve-Tolosane

Villeneuve-Tolosane (French pronunciation: [vilnœv tɔlozan]; Occitan: Vilanava Tolosana) is a commune in the Haute-Garonne department in southwestern France.

Population

The inhabitants of the commune are known as Villeneuvois, Villeneuvoises.
